Dome Tents
While many factors go into choosing the right tent for a given trip, dome outdoors tents are usually favored due to their livability and durability. They are typically lightweight, with polyester or nylon fabric blends and plenty of mesh. They additionally often tend to have light weight aluminum camping tent poles, which are lighter and stronger than other types of tent posts.
An additional advantage of dome outdoors tents is their adaptability. They can be utilized in a range of settings, including occasions and glamping. They are additionally much less sensitive to the wind compared to tunnel outdoors tents.
The Kelty Wireless is a wonderful instance of a high quality dome camping tent that provides both livability and resilience. This six-person tent features 2 doors and vestibules (both the Coleman Skydome and Sundome just have one) in addition to a full-coverage rain fly, which is useful in damp problems. Nevertheless, it uses fiberglass outdoor tents posts, which aren't as solid as aluminum alternatives. This isn't a deal-breaker for the majority of, however it is worth remembering.

Trailer Tents
Some trailer tents utilize the trailer body itself to create part of the sleeping area. These 'stroller hood' kind trailer tents are extremely fast to pitch and very cosy in chilly and damp weather. They are normally additionally very little to permit them to fit in the back of a small vehicle - extremely valuable if you have limited home storage room for such a camping unit. A lot of versions of this type include a vestibule which is a floorless protected area outside the main door and utilized for saving equipment.
Other trailer camping tents are a little bit like folding campers and campers, with an inner camping tent being in a frame on top of the trailer body. A few of these versions can have awnings to increase living space. This type of trailer camping tent is ideal matched to those that want to spend the shortest time feasible pitching up and taking down. Suppliers provide a vast array of optional bonus, including kitchen systems and beds/couchettes, to boost the convenience degree of this type of tent.
